Private family seeks an exceptional full-time Private Chef to create unparalleled culinary experiences that blend artistry and sophistication, with a strong focus on nutrition and wellness. The Chef will oversee all daily culinary needs at the family’s primary residence in Palm Beach, FL, and spend the summer season in Southampton, NY. The ideal candidate will bring extensive Michelin Star restaurant experience, with proven expertise in delivering refined, innovative, and wellness-driven cuisine. A background in organic, nutritious cooking and mastery of both Japanese and authentic Italian cuisines are essential. The family seeks a Chef who approaches food as both art and nourishment, someone who can translate world-class technique into fresh, beautifully balanced, health-conscious meals.
Candidates must demonstrate a commitment to excellence, reliability, and adaptability, along with the capacity to travel with the family between residences. Relocation expenses will be covered for candidates residing outside of the Palm Beach area. Competitive compensation and benefits are offered for the right individual who embodies culinary artistry, precision, and a genuine passion for exceptional private service.
This role follows a five-day workweek, typically Monday through Friday, with flexibility to work weekends and extended hours during the summer months or as needed. The position requires professionalism, discretion, and the ability to work collaboratively with existing household staff. Daily responsibilities include curating and executing customized menus aligned with the family’s preferences, with dinner service at 6:00 p.m. and occasional lunches. The Chef will manage ingredient sourcing, kitchen organization, and menu planning, maintaining the highest standards of quality, freshness, and sustainability.
